Reincarnation



 


Reincarnation, also known as rebirth or transmigration, is the belief that each of us goes through a series of lifetimes for the purpose of spiritual growth and soul development.

The origin of reincarnation is not the most obvious, with so many religions and various cultures all claiming the concept, however, historians have traced the first recording of reincarnation being mentioned in the writings of Plato in the 5th century.

Among the ancient Greeks, the Orphic mystery religion held that a preexistent soul survives bodily death and is later reincarnated in a human or other mammalian body, eventually receiving release from the cycle of birth and death and regaining its former pure state.

Hinduism - Reincarnation or rebirth can be defined as getting born again in a living form after death. The word reincarnation literally means "entering the flesh again.". Punarjanma is the Sanskrit word for reincarnation. Punarjanma literally means rebirth.The first reference to reincarnation idea is at least 2600 years. It appears in the Upanishads, the sacred scriptures of Hinduism,

At the beginning of the Christian era, reincarnation was one of the pillars of belief.  Reincarnation has never officially been condoned by the Catholic Church or any of the major Protestant churches. But it was an almost universal belief among the many Gnostic and pagan sects that proliferated in the first three centuries of our era.
